I had my 04 RX330 in the dealer today for the driver doos seals. My salesman was there and we exchanged greetings. I asked when they were getting the 400, he pointed to one that was there with the lexus rep. So I asked to drive it.

I was the first one in the dealership to drive it.. as tall the salesman were drooling.

First looks, the interior is about the same. Then turn the key and you will see the power train display on the screen, there is also a display below the speedometer, this shows the regenerative braking and charging.

It is so strange to turn the key on and not hear an engine running. So you step on the gas and it goes. Smooth, no hesitation at all, quiet. No more sloppy shifting, can't hardly feel any shifts, just power...

As will smith said in Independance day "I gota get me one of these"

The cars are being delivered without Mark Levinson or rear entertainment package.

But can be ordered, which I will.

I was not that impressed with the Mark Levinson system, which this car had.

My standard premium with my own subwoofer sounds better..

The rear seats sit up a little higher and there are vents just below the seats so air can run over the batteries. The battery warranty is 100,000 miles or 8 years.

The breakwater blue which is my favorite will NOT be available on the 400, in fact no light blue at all, that hurts....

I've wondered a bit about the heating. I'm not much concerned about it in my mild winter climate, but I've wondered how well it will do in a very cold climate like Minnesota. I haven't heard that the engine cycles on just to produce heat. If one sits and idles long enough, it will have to come on for battery drain. I have read that it has an electric water pump to circulate the water so that the heat will still get delivered when the engine is off but that still assumes that the engine was on at some point to heat up.

I expect in normal driving the engine is on enough of the time to provide enough heat, but what about when traffic is stopped or going very slowly (like when there is a road problem going over the Sierra in the winter). Well, I guess one can pop on the seat heaters and throw a sleeping bag to the back seat passengers. The seat heaters will drain the battery giving the engine an excuse to run.

I drove a 400h this afternoon. It was about 86 degrees out. When I turned the key the Ready light came on right away. Before I moved the car, the engine did come on, I think it was because it tried to cool the car which was outside in the sun.

Acceleration was wonderful; especially between 30 and 65. I even took it up to 75 mph. The brakes required a little more pressure than my '99 RX. The steering was a little tighter than the 330, but looser than the '99RX300. The engine was smooth. With the windows open you could hear the engine when accelerating, but it wasn't extreme or the whine they talked about. Overall, I was very impressed with the car.
